Chris Woodley & Jeff Tyndall plan to re-start the skills coaching sessions on Monday evenings from 29/4/13. These sessions are aimed at anyone who wishes to improve their paddling skills both on flat water (leading, if desired, towards the BCU two star and Paddlepower awards) and on moving water. The sessions will take place at a variety of venues including Saul Junction, Fromebridge Mill & Symonds Yat, with hopefully a visit to a friendly river surfing wave at some point.
